best chicken cacciatore

yield 6 serving(s)
prep time 20 Min
cook time 45 Min
method Stove Top

Ingredients For best chicken cacciatore

  • 1/4 c
    cooking oil
  • 6
    chicken breasts with ribs
  • 2 md
    onions, cut in 1/4 inch slices
  • 1
    1 pound can tomatoes, squished up
  • 1
    8 oz. can tomato sauce
  • 1 tsp
    salt
  • 1/4 tsp
    black pepper
  • 1 tsp
    dried oregano
  • 1/2 tsp
    celery seed
  • 1 or 2
    bay leaves
  • 1
    rounded te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1/4 c
    white wine or sauterne

How To Make best chicken cacciatore

  • 1
    Brown the chicken breasts in skillet with the oil.
  • 2
    Remove chicken. Saute the onions and garlic powder in same pan that you browned the chicken in. Do not let onions brown. Just until tender.
  • 3
    Combine the tomatoes, tomatoe sauce, salt, pepper, oregano, celery seed and bay leaves. Put the chicken back in the skillet and pour tomato mixture over same. Cover and simmer for 30 minutes. Then stir in white wine and cook uncovered for another 15 minutes or until chicken is tender. Turn occasionally. Remove bay leaves.
  • 4
    NOTE: If you are serving this dish with mashed potatoes or rice, you might want to double the sauce portion of the recipe. It's mighty good over taters or rice.
